## Who to ping about GiftNote

Welcome aboard! GiftNote is our donation-receipt mailer for the Larchfield Fund. Template tweaks go to the comms folks; delivery failures and bounce weirdness go to the platform crew. Don't push template changes on Fridays — receipts batch over the weekend. For anything GiftNote-related, start with the address below.

billing contact of kaweg-tajeg = drudor.lamion.oliath@torvalabs.test

Fan-out backpressure for the Quillet notifier: when the queue depth crosses the soft limit, the dispatcher sheds low-priority pushes and batches the rest at 500ms intervals. Reviewer should confirm the shed counter is exported and that retries respect the jitter window. Once merged, the release artifact gets re-signed by the pipeline, which expects the deploy key shown below.

deploy key for bawep-yawif: bky6_GQhaSt

Handover for reception — contractor week one. Dasha Quill from Ferrowick Systems starts Monday on the Larkspur refit. She'll sign in daily, hard hat stored in the back cupboard. Escort her to Level 3 only; no workshop access yet. Deliveries for her go to the loading bay. Her induction is booked Tuesday with Marit. Her temporary door code is below.

turnstile pass: bdg-YPPQB-52010